A new and effective approach to boron removal by using novel boron-specific fungi isolated from boron mining wastewater
Boron-resistant fungi were isolated from the wastewater of a boron mine in Turkey. Boron removal efficiencies of Penicillium crustosum and Rhodotorula mucilaginosa were detected in different media compositions.
